Boeing is seeking a Transportation Analyst (Level 3 or Level 4) to join their Category Logistics team. This role is responsible for managing transportation processes, providing shipment support, identifying cost-effective solutions, analyzing transportation data, and executing international freight transactions in compliance with regulatory requirements. The position requires experience in freight forwarding, transportation modes, data analysis, and stakeholder partnership.

What you'd actually do

  1. Manage transportation processes to support customer requirements and business objectives
  2. Provide shipment support including problem resolution, tracking, and expedite management
  3. Identify cost-effective transportation solutions that maintain service, efficiency, and on-time performance
  4. Research, estimate, and negotiate transportation options and carrier solutions
  5. Analyze transportation data and recommend actions based on cost, transit time, mode selection, and performance trends
